GREEN LOGISTICS: FUTURE PROSPECTS FOR DEVELOPING SUSTAINABLE TRANSPORT AND ECO-FRIENDLY LOGISTICS SYSTEMS

This article examines the role and significance of green logistics in ensuring environmental sustainability and improving the efficiency of modern transport and logistics systems. The study analyzes the impact of logistics activities on the environment, including greenhouse gas emissions, energy consumption, and waste generation. Particular attention is given to sustainable transportation solutions, the integration of innovative technologies, renewable energy sources, and digital management systems in logistics processes. The article also explores international experience and best practices in implementing environmentally friendly logistics strategies. Based on the analysis, recommendations are proposed for enhancing the environmental performance and competitiveness of transport and logistics systems through the adoption of green logistics principles. The findings indicate that green logistics serves as an essential tool for achieving sustainable economic development while reducing negative environmental impacts.
